What Our Deep Cleaning Service Includes
Deep cleaning is a top-to-bottom, room-by-room service that targets areas standard cleaning often misses. We tackle built-up grime, grease, limescale and dust, paying special attention to high-use and high-contact areas.
Typical areas and items included
- All rooms: dusting, wiping and disinfecting of surfaces, skirting boards, doors, switches and handles
- Kitchens: degreasing of hob, extractor hood, tiles, cupboard exteriors and handles; cleaning worktops, sinks and splashbacks
- Bathrooms: descaling taps, shower screens, heads and tiles; cleaning toilets, sinks, baths and plugholes
- Floors: vacuuming throughout; hard floor mopping with appropriate solutions
- Carpets & rugs: optional professional carpet cleaning using our specialist equipment
- Upholstery: optional sofa and upholstery cleaning to remove stains, odours and general soiling
What is not included as standard
To keep our pricing transparent, some tasks are not automatically included in a deep clean but can usually be added on request:
- Exterior window cleaning above ground-floor level
- Specialist stain or odour removal beyond normal expectations
- Cleaning of ceilings at height requiring towers or specialist access
- Garden, balcony or exterior pressure washing
- Decluttering or removal of large quantities of rubbish
If you are unsure whether something is included, we will confirm this clearly during your quotation so you know exactly what to expect.

Our Step-by-Step Deep Cleaning Process
1. Enquiry & Clear Quotation
Once you contact Notting Hill Carpet Cleaning, we discuss your property type, size and priorities. We ask a few practical questions so we can estimate time and staffing accurately. You then receive a clear quotation with no hidden extras, outlining what is included and any optional add-ons such as carpet or upholstery cleaning.
2. Survey – Virtual or Onsite
Depending on the size and condition of the property, we may carry out a short virtual survey (photos or video call) or an onsite visit. This allows us to assess access, parking, flooring types and any areas requiring special attention. The survey helps us allocate the right equipment and number of cleaners, so the work is completed efficiently and to a high standard.
3. Preparation & Protection
On the day, our trained team arrives on time in uniform with all necessary materials and machinery. We walk through the property with you where possible, confirm priorities, and identify any delicate items. We then protect flooring where needed, move light furniture carefully, and plan the order of work so each room is cleaned systematically with minimal disruption.
4. Thorough Deep Clean
We work methodically from top to bottom, room by room. Dusting, degreasing, descaling and disinfecting are carried out using appropriate, professional-grade products. For carpets and upholstery, our professional cleaning machines extract deep-down dirt rather than just lifting surface dust. We finish with a final check to ensure all agreed areas have been completed to our standards.

Why Choose Professional Deep Cleaning Instead of DIY
While a general tidy and light clean can be done yourself, truly effective deep cleaning requires time, technique and equipment that most households do not have. Our teams use commercial-grade machines and cleaning solutions that remove deeply embedded dirt, dust mites, grease and bacteria more efficiently and safely.
We work to a structured checklist so no corners are skipped, and we understand how to treat different surfaces – from delicate upholstery to modern flooring finishes – without causing damage. For many of our Notting Hill clients, bringing in professionals saves an entire weekend of hard work and achieves a noticeably higher standard of cleanliness.
